Book excerpt: A wide-ranging study of the painted panorama’s influence on art, photography, and film This ambitious volume presents a multifaceted account of the legacy of the circular painted panorama and its far-reaching influence on art, photography, film, and architecture. From its 18th-century origins, the panorama quickly became a global mass-cultural phenomenon, often linked to an imperial worldview. Yet it also transformed modes of viewing and exerted a lasting, visible impact on filmmaking techniques, museum displays, and contemporary installation art. On the Viewing Platform offers close readings of works ranging from proto-panoramic Renaissance cityscapes and 19th-century paintings and photographs to experimental films and a wide array of contemporary art. Extensively researched and spectacularly illustrated, this volume proposes an expansive new framework for understanding the histories of art, film, and spectatorship.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from Parley's Panorama, or Curiosities of Nature and Art, History and Biography It has been often said that truth is more wonderful than fiction. The force of this observation is manifest to those who have a liberal acquaintance with books, or have otherwise stored their minds from the great treasuries of human knowledge and experience. To the ignorant, trifles often appear mysterious and wonderful; while things really amazing are viewed with indifference. To a child, the blaze of a candle is an object of intense admiration. When it appears, it excites delight; when it vanishes, it creates wonder. But the moon, which to the instructed mind suggests ideas of the most lofty and sublime nature, excites in the infant only a transient and vague emotion, to be replaced by images of toys and baubles. It is thus, in proportion as the mind is cultivated and enlarged, that the wonders of Nature and Art, of History and Biography, become topics of interest, and sources of reflection and enjoyment. The more of truth there is in the mind, the more does truth itself become attractive. The appetite for knowledge knows no satiety; it increases as it is fed; its relish is the keener in proportion as it is indulged. In this view of the subject, we have collected a variety of remarkable facts, calculated to gratify curiosity, and impart instruction.
